Marvel is releasing an all-new ongoing ALIEN series by creators Declan Shalvey and Andrea Broccardo.
That sound you hear is the echo of millions of sci-fi fans' heads and chests bursting with delight: The 'Alien' series is starting anew. After strategically releasing concept art through his Twitter feed, Neil Blomkamp has scored...

